### Reviewing the Reminder Job

When reviewing changes to Larkhollow Clinic's appointment reminder job, confirm that retry logic stays idempotent and that patient batches remain under the send limit. Staging verification requires unlocking the test credentials vault, which prompts for the recovery passphrase; the current value appears directly below.

recovery phrase for fawif-tajeg: norael-aldmir-casir-brivan-ulaion

## Diff viewer: large-file handling

Adds chunked rendering to the Tidemark diff viewer so files over the inline threshold stream rather than load fully into memory. No user content is written to disk; chunks live in a bounded in-process cache. Paths are normalized before fetch to prevent traversal. The size and cache limits in effect are defined below.

tuning table, faduf-baduf:
PRIORITIES = {
    "ulavan": 191,
    "silys": 750,
    "goriel": 238,
    "kelmir": 66,
    "wendor": 432,
}

## Onboarding: Currency Rounding in Ledgerweave

As a security reviewer, note that Ledgerweave converts all amounts to minor units before applying exchange rates, then rounds half-to-even at the final step only. Intermediate truncation caused a reconciliation drift of up to 0.4% in the old Marstead pipeline, which was classified as an integrity risk. All rounding paths are logged and signed. To audit the signing store, you must unlock the reviewer vault using the passphrase below.

vault phrase of bagaf-kajeg = jorath-feniel-briir-siliel-ralix